Atoms For Peace and Stanley Donwood opening Drawing Room in London

Atoms For Peace and Stanley Donwood will be opening the Drawing Room in London at The Enterprise, which is located across the street from London Roundhouse where Atoms For Peace will be playing for three consecutive nights (July 24, 25 and 26).  XL Recordings says the Drawing Room will consist of: “an Atoms For Peace-themed visual wonderland. Part-gallery, part-shop and part hanging-out space, it will feature handmade and exclusive vinyl, posters and curiosities for sale, many of which will be ‘live printed’ in The Drawing Room on a specially-installed silk screen printing press.”

Atoms For Peace offering High-Quality Audio and Video from London shows through Soundhalo

Atoms For Peace will be offering downloads and streaming of two of their upcoming  three shows in London on the 25th and 26th through Soundhalo.

Nigel Godrich on Soundhalo:

“Part of the reason Soundhalo was interesting to me was that I found myself wondering why, whenever you go to a gig, the next day there are a million shaky, horrible sounding YouTube videos already online, but you go and look because you want to see something of your experience. Soundhalo provides something really functional– an experience that you want to remember in front of you as soon as the concert has happened. To be able to relive that is a really great thing.”
